special

Original meaning: bull

Phonosemantic compound. represents the meaning and represents the sound. Based on the original meaning "bull". The meaning later shifted to "prominent" and "special".

Zhengzhang Shangfang

(nose), self

Original meaning: nose

Pictograph of a nose. Original form of (nose). In China, when people point to themselves, they typically point to their nose.

zhì govern

Original meaning: river in Shandong

Phonosemantic compound. represents the meaning and represents the sound. Originally referred to a river in Shandong province. The current meaning is a phonetic loan.
